DOS migration considerations
New LAN drivers are required, with modifications to LAN configuration files such as
PROTOCOL.INI. Modifications to CONFIG.SYS and AUTOEXEC.BAT are also
required.
Windows and Linux migration considerations
To migrate a Windows or Linux environment, first reinstall the operating system.
Then, install the appropriate drivers (downloaded from the IBM Retail Store
Solutions Web site at http://www2.clearlake.ibm.com/store/support/html/
surepos700.html), and install the applications.

RAID
The Redundant Array of Independent Disks (RAID) function provides support for
redundant hard disk drives. Supported only on the Microsoft Windows operating
systems, RAID provides an error message if one of the two hard disk drives
experiences a failure. For more information, see the SurePOS 700-723/743/783/784
Operating System Installation Guide, GA27-5002.
